i found some info for you, 2 CR.32 losses in 24.8.38:
cr-32 3-97 Chapaprieta , muerto en accion (KIA)
cr-32, 3-135 Lacour, prisionero. (POW)
the other claim was by Tarazona
place: Mora del Ebro
